The Myth of Consistent Sprinting

Many guides suggest maintaining a steady sprint to build momentum early in the run. This approach assumes that speed is always beneficial, but it neglects the critical need for precise positioning and collision avoidance. In Short Ride, a bikeriding action game where players navigate deadly obstacle courses on a bicycle, constantly sprinting leads to catastrophic failure. The environment features rotating sawblades and narrow pathways that require the player to modulate their speed. A consistent high velocity prevents the necessary micro-adjustments in balance and timing required to dodge these hazards without triggering a collision detection penalty.

The Trap of Reactive Dodging

Finally, advice often encourages reacting only after an obstacle appears on screen. In fast-paced endless runners like Godzilla Runner Game, where players control a massive creature charging through a dangerous city, waiting to react is fatal. The sheer speed of the game combined with the size of the protagonist means that by the time an enemy or building registers on the screen, there is insufficient distance left to maneuver. Players must anticipate threats based on pattern recognition and audio cues rather than relying solely on visual triggers.

Self-Teaching Framework for Mastery

Beyond debunking these myths, players can adopt a self-teaching framework rooted in iterative practice and reflection:

  1. Analyze Failure States: When a run ends, identify exactly where the player failed—did they hit an obstacle? Did speed become unmanageable?
  2. Practice Velocity Modulation: In Short Ride, focus on alternating between acceleration and controlled braking to match obstacle density rather than maintaining a constant sprint.
  3. Predictive Pattern Recognition: In Godzilla Runner Game, memorize enemy spawn intervals and movement arcs. Anticipate threats before they appear, allowing for smoother navigation through the cityscape.
